Output b5bae6cffab0616fdbcfa21cfaace714eab9086b215639405863310f91314ea5:2

value
6230051150
script pubkey
OP_0 OP_PUSHBYTES_20 a593e030dc43acfe1ed668bd5041f195945672aa
address
tb1q5kf7qvxugwk0u8kkdz74qs03jk29vu42fdpj97
transaction
b5bae6cffab0616fdbcfa21cfaace714eab9086b215639405863310f91314ea5
confirmations
74033
spent
true